Johnny Manziel can empathize with Todd Gurley these days.

Like the Georgia tailback, Manziel also was a Heisman trophy contender investigated by the NCAA for signing autographs for compensation last year.

Now, it’s Gurley who’s in trouble and suspended indefinitely after allegedly accepting money in exchange for his autographs.

The Cleveland Browns backup quarterback wasted no time and went on Twitter to support Gurley.

Manziel was suspended for just one half after his autograph scandal last fall, but it’s unclear how much time Gurley will miss.

The Bulldogs running back was having a strong junior year prior to his suspension. He has rushed for 773 yards on 94 carries and is a big reason why Georgia is ranked No. 13 in the nation.
